AI GPTs for Patent Learning are sophisticated tools powered by Generative Pre-trained Transformers, specifically tailored for the domain of patents and intellectual property. These tools utilize advanced machine learning algorithms to process, analyze, and generate patent-related content. By leveraging vast amounts of data, they provide tailored solutions for various tasks in the patent field, such as patent analysis, drafting, and research, making them indispensable for innovators, legal professionals, and researchers.

Essential Attributes and Functionalities

The core features of AI GPTs for Patent Learning include their adaptability to perform a wide range of tasks from simple data retrieval to complex patent analysis and generation. Key capabilities encompass natural language understanding and generation, technical document analysis, trend identification, and predictive modeling. Special features may include multilingual support, integration with patent databases for real-time information retrieval, and tools for visualizing patent landscapes.
